Emerging Green Processing Technologies for Beverages, Volume Seven in the Developments in Food Quality and Safety series, covers the fundamentals and recent trends in the processing of different beverages, such as herbal beverages, fresh produce-based beverages, and dairy beverages. Chapters cover a broad range of beverages to enhance knowledge in quality retention and shelf life extension. Sections summarize the influence of green technologies on nutritional quality, microbial safety, and physico-chemical characteristics. Edited by Dr. José Manuel Lorenzo and authored by a team of global experts, this book provides comprehensive knowledge to food industry personnel and scientists.

This is the most up-to-date resource, covering trend topics such as Advances in the analysis of toxic compounds and control of food poisoning; Food fraud, traceability and authenticity; Revalorization of agrifood industry; Natural antimicrobial compounds and application to improve the preservation of food; Non-thermal processing technologies in the food industry; Nanotechnology in food production; and Intelligent packaging and sensors for food applications.

Dr. Roji Waghmare is an Assistant Professor at the Institute of Chemical Technology (ICT), Matunga, Mumbai, India. She has worked on various green non-thermal techniques such as cold plasma, irradiation, ultrasonication and pulsed light. She has also worked in the field of functional beverages, preservation of fresh produce, 3D food printing and drying. As Assistant Professor at D Y Patil University in Navi Mumbai, India, Dr. Roji guided various research projects based on functional beverages, waste utilization, shelf-life extension of fruits and vegetables. Her work on development of non-dairy fermented probiotic drink based on germinated and ungerminated cereals and legume was highly acclaimed and published in LWT-Food Science and Technology. At Indian Institute of Food Processing Technology, Tamil Nadu, India, she has worked on preservation of fresh product by different drying techniques including freeze drying, refractance window drying and spray drying.
